Over 40,000 students to be enrolled to universities this year: UGC Chairman

18 February 2021 01:36 am

More than 40,000 students will be enrolled to all the 15 Universities in the country this year, University Grants Commission (UGC) Chairman Senior Prof. Sampath Amaratunga said.

Speaking to the media at the Information Centre today, he said it was a great victory that the UGC had received even during this pandemic situation.

Only 30,000 students were enrolled annually, but this year the number of students is increased by 10,569.

Accordingly, the increased number of students enrolled in certain faculties of the universities are as follows:

Medical 491,  Engineering 565,  Science 2,972, Technology 1,099, Commerce and Management 1,803, Arts 1,680 and Aesthetic subjects 318, the Prof. Amaratunga said. (Chaturanga Samarawickrama)
